S.1189

Revises certain eligibility requirements under NJ Aspire Program; establishes net neutral benefits test for redevelopment projects that incur certain sustainability and resiliency costs.

Introduced·1/9/24
Introduced Text

Revises eligibility requirements for New Jersey Aspire Program tax credits; establishes net neutral benefits test for redevelopment projects with.

The bill amends the New Jersey Aspire Program to revise eligibility criteria for tax credits. It mandates the New Jersey Economic Development Authority to conduct a net neutral benefit analysis for redevelopment projects with a total cost of at least $17 million, including at least $3.4 million in sustainability and resiliency costs. These costs include carbon reduction initiatives, electric vehicle charging infrastructure, geothermal heat pumps, stormwater management systems, brownfield site remediation, historic property rehabilitation, and living shorelines.
